EXECUTIVE ORDER 13092
PRESIDENT'S INFORMATION TECHNOLOGY ADVISORY COMMITTEE, AMENDMENTS TO EXECUTIVE ORDER 13035
By the authority vested in me as President by the Constitution and the laws of the United States of America, including the High-Performance Computing Act of 1991 (Public Law 102-194), and in order to add five more members to, and to change the name of the Advisory Committee on High-Performance Computing and Communications, Information Technology, and the Next Generation Internet, it is hereby ordered that Executive Order 13035 of February 11, 1997, is amended as follows:
